Peggy Hunter Ullmann, CPA
Member
Term expires July 3, 2031
Peggy Ullmann is the founder of Ullmann & Company, a professional accounting practice she operated with passion for over 30 years. Ullmann & Company continues under the direction and management of her successors. Peggy remains active in the profession through her national volunteer activities, recently as a hearing officer for the AICPA Joint Trial Board and member of the Professional Ethics Executive Committee of the AICPA.
Over the years, she has participated in the direction of the profession, both nationally and in local tax and accounting policy and legislation. Nationally, she served as Director on the Board of the American Institute of CPAs and as the AICPA Federal Key Person Delegate for federal tax and accounting policy and legislation. She also served on the AICPA Council and strategic AICPA committees, including the Management of Accounting Practice and Private Company Practice Section planning bodies. She was a member of the AICPA “Group of 100”, a national strategic planning body for the CPA profession, charged with predicting and providing guidance for changes affecting the future of the accounting profession. She was a member of the faculty of the American Institute of CPA’s National Tax Education Program held at the University of Illinois. Within her home state, Peggy served as the Chair of the Arizona Society of CPAs and has represented Arizona CPAs before certain Arizona State legislative committees presenting information and response on a variety of accounting and tax matters. She served as Chairman of the Board of the Arizona Federal Tax Institute. She is the former President of the Arizona CPA Foundation for Education and Innovation. This foundation supports the CPA profession by encouraging the best students through scholarships and awards to university educators.
Peggy has provided tax and accounting services to many individual and business clients, from tax planning and compliance for individuals to consulting and strategy for closely-held business operations, including financial reporting, budgeting and planning, tax planning, transaction structuring and analysis, capital acquisition support, and IRS federal income and excise tax audit representation. She has provided consulting, tax and accounting services to certain regulated Arizona business industries, including privately owned, regulated water and sewer companies and Arizona based State Tuition Organizations.
She earned a Masters in Accountancy/Taxation and Bachelor of Science in Finance from Arizona State University where she graduated magna cum laude.
